Geography
Fălești is nestled in a valley surrounded by rolling hills, vineyards, and lush forests. The Răut River flows through the town, adding to its scenic beauty. The town experiences a continental climate with hot summers and cold winters, making it an ideal destination for outdoor enthusiasts all year round.
